Turnover Rate
-Correct Answer-The time it takes for the entire volume of water in a pool to
be filtered and recirculated.
Filter Area
,-Correct Answer-The surface area of the filter media used in a pool's
filtering system.
Filter Media Rate
-Correct Answer-The rate at which water is filtered through a specific area
of filter media, typically measured in gallons per minute per square foot.

Flow Rate
-Correct Answer-The volume of water that is circulated through the pool's
filtering system, typically measured in gallons per minute.
Diatomaceous Earth Filter
-Correct Answer-A type of filter that uses diatomaceous earth as the
filtering medium.
Suction Velocity
-Correct Answer-The maximum speed at which water can flow through the
suction piping of a pump, measured in feet per second.

Breakpoint Chlorine
-Correct Answer-The level of chlorine in pool water after all combined
chlorine has been oxidized.
pH Reading
-Correct Answer-The measurement of acidity or alkalinity of pool water.
Total Dissolved Solids (TDS)
-Correct Answer-The total concentration of dissolved substances in pool
water, measured in parts per million.
Water Alkalinity
-Correct Answer-The ability of water to resist changes in pH, typically
measured in parts per million.
